Unburden Your Systems Administrator
Allow designated users to:
- change passwords for others
- clear jammed printer queues
- start backup processes
- manage log files
- kill hung jobs or users
- mount file systems
- reboot selected systems.
The key benefit to any organization in deploying UPM is its ability to relieve expensive and busy systems administrators from routine day-to-day tasks, which are better handled by local departments. UNIX functionality dictates that to give someone the ability to manage printers or cancel hung users or jobs within their department, we must give them the ability to manage these tasks in all departments. UPM provides fine-grained control over such privileges, saving the time of one of your most expensive and busy people -your administrator.
